THE CONDENSING CHARACTERISTICS OF NITROGEN IN PLAIN, BRAZED ALUMINIUM, PLATE-FIN HEAT-EXCHANGER PASSAGES

Sinopsis

Condensing heat transfer coefficients and pressure gradients have been obtained with nitrogen in vertical downflow in a plain, plate-fin test section for a range of low mass fluxes and pressures. In the paper, the measured coefficients are compared with predictions from the Nusselt and Dukler and other methods, none of which is satisfactory. A new model of condensing with a falling film is advanced: it takes into account turbulence and the shear stress variation across the film. By using a double velocity profile and the measured pressure gradients, the new method gives better predictions for these small rectangular finned channels.
